We are seeking a skilled and experienced Audit and Risk Manager to join our team. The Audit and Risk Manager will be responsible for coordinating and overseeing the internal audit function and managing the organization’s risk management processes.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in auditing, risk management, and compliance, with the ability to provide strategic guidance and recommendations to senior management.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Operational responsibility for matters related to the Company’s internal controls, risk management processes/procedures, and compliance matters, including:
  • Reviewing and evaluating the Company’s risk management processes and procedures and identifying areas of improvement.
  • Collaborating and coordinating with department heads to establish the enterprise risk management framework, policies, procedures, and controls.
  • Providing recommendations and advising on desirable changes in policies, procedures, and systems to manage and mitigate identified risks to the Company.
  • Initiating and implementing effective internal control systems.
  • Developing and implementing annual audit plans based on a thorough risk assessment of the organization.
  • Conducting follow-ups on all audit assignments given to external auditors.
  • Working with management to resolve issues identified through audit findings.
  • Building and advising the team to ensure legal compliance and achievement of organizational goals.
  • Researching and identifying internal and external risk factors (economic, markets, operational, regulatory, etc.) and developing strategies to prevent potentially harmful activities or practices.
  • Routinely evaluating the effectiveness of risk policies and procedures and collaborating with internal stakeholders to monitor changes in the business environment.
  • Monitoring compliance with the Company’s internal policies and procedures.
  • Reviewing and evaluating the Company’s compliance with legal and regulatory requirements.
  • Preparing audit, risk, and compliance reports for Management and the Board Audit and Risk Committee to summarize the Company’s compliance status.
  • Assisting in preparing the required periodic compliance reports to the regulator (TIRA) and other relevant authorities, including but not limited to the Finance Intelligence Unit (FIU).
  • Staying abreast of industry best practices, regulatory requirements, and emerging risks to ensure the Company remains compliant and well-prepared.
  • Conducting or organizing training for staff regarding risk management and compliance matters.
  • Performing any other relevant duties as delegated by any upline Manager.

Education Including Specialized Training:

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, business administration, or a related field. A master’s degree or professional certification (e.g., CPA, CIA, CISA) is preferred.
  • Knowledge/training on compliance requirements by insurance companies to regulations by the regulatory bodies TIRA, TRA is an added advantage.

Work Experience:

  • Proven experience in internal auditing, risk management, or a related field, with at least 5 years of experience in a managerial role, preferably in an insurance or audit firm.
  • Strong knowledge of auditing standards, risk assessment techniques, and regulatory requirements.
  • Excellent anal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ively interact with st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
  • Proven leadership and team management abilities.
  •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ines.
